Output 5162fb0807fcc1a5c20eb03b84f5383c73e96d4758b024fdbeffc654e8da51a2:16

value
101953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62fbc4dcedc67ac8047bc8d5d6d7b9d7a7d45bd2 OP_EQUAL
address
3AiPkZQxFP1ppJGeZWvirkrd7meyV49Y6V
transaction
5162fb0807fcc1a5c20eb03b84f5383c73e96d4758b024fdbeffc654e8da51a2
confirmations
107667
spent
true